Output e386f6de0dee9ae6ee3d09e5f5cb0787d8a90a23c70800cefec358d5f6bd8c76:5

value
103554
script pubkey
OP_0 OP_PUSHBYTES_20 c584126efe87bd9d2088d293dbcc5e5379a6f579
address
bc1qckzpymh7s77e6gyg62fahnz72du6dates2uclz
transaction
e386f6de0dee9ae6ee3d09e5f5cb0787d8a90a23c70800cefec358d5f6bd8c76
confirmations
16574
spent
true